We continue our Reconsidered Leadership series with part 4: Antifragility. Taking the theory by Nassim Nicholas Taleb from the book by the same name, we consider how leadership that is made different in the "key of Christ," is self-emptying and "apophatic" leads us to help our followers not become fragile, but more than resilient. This is nothing but antifragility, and it is unique to the Cross and Resurrection of Jesus Christ that His strength is more than robust, but weakness, suffering, and strife transfigured by the Resurrection.
